IT and Digital Media Officer
- Career Category: Computer - General, Media, Computer - Networking, Computer - Programming
- Schedule:Full-time
- Salary: Negotiable
Supervisor : Project Coordinator
- Digital Media
- Develop and advise high-quality digital content for the organization’s website and social media channels, while exploring a range of multimedia assets, to engage target audiences and raise the external profile of the organization;
- Update and implement an effective social media, emails to grow readership/followers, and manage the organization’s social media accounts (including moderating discussions and comments);
- Oversee and enhance all digital media channels, especially multimedia in the context of modern digital era;
- Manage WMC social media platforms/ Posting (Facebook, YouTube, Tik Tok, and other platforms) to raise brand awareness among the public and stakeholders;
- Search relevant pictures, edit video clips to develop digital media productions;
- Enhance and boost social media to optimize the audience;
- Conduct analysis on social media metrics by studying the viewers’ behavior, engagements, and WMC’s social media performances;
- Ensure data protection and confidentiality by all staff within the organization
- IT
- Manage the overall technology infrastructure for the organization including planning, implementing, and management of the software applications and hardware infrastructure that support operations, liaising as relevant with technology service providers.
- Support and contribute to IT-related tasks or projects;
- Act as the principal administrator and ensure the maintenance of the organization's systems, including general computer support, software installations, license management, server setup and management, database administration, network, printers, deployment of equipment, periodic security vulnerability assessments, and updating hardware and software;
- Control the website of the organization for a secure place and well-functioning;
- Update websites of the organization as demand;
- Provide user training on common applications and use of systems;
- Support the procurement process for IT equipment and services;

- English - Good
- Khmer - Fluent is required
- Bachelor's Degree in Information and Technology and/or Digital Communications
- Experience in the field for 3 years as a minimum
- Technical background and experience as a web programmer or webmaster
- Wider understanding of social, economic, cultural, civil and political environment.
- Cambodian national, who is mother tongue in Khmer language.
- Proficiency in English (listening, reading, writing and speaking)
- Interested in working to develop independent and professional media, and to empower gender equality in Cambodia.
